Powerbloggers stay clear. This is strictly for newbies.

I discovered Reader a year into blogging on WordPress.

  • What is Reader?

Its that icon up there sandwitched between ‘blog name’ and ‘follow’ on your blog site.

Its the window that permits you to peer into your peers – I mean, fellow bloggers.

It lists

a] Latest posts by the Blogs you follow get updated here. You can either glimpse a preview or read entire post, depending on walls erected by that WordPress Blogger.
